body {
	background-image:url(img/backgrd.jpg); background-repeat:repeat-x; background-color:#C7EAFE;
	padding: 0;	margin: 0; font-family: arial, helvetica, sans-serif;
	font-size: 82%;	text-align: center;	color: #000000;
	}

a:link, a:visited { color:#0066CC }
a:hover { color:#FF7800 }

#nav_oben a:link, #nav_oben a:visited { color:#909090 }
#nav_oben a:hover, #nav_oben a:active { color:#FF7800 }
#nav_oben a.aktiv:link, #nav_oben a.aktiv:visited { color:#FF7800 }


#seite {
	background-color: #ffffff;
	width: 984px;
	margin-right: auto;
	margin-left: auto;
	padding: 0px;
	text-align: left;
	}
#seite2 { position:relative;top:0;left:0;width:984px; /*height:800px;*/ background-color:white }

#logo { position:absolute; left:40px; top:0px; }
#sprache { position:absolute; right:20px; top:20px; }
#hotline { position:absolute; right:20px; top:59px; color:#888888; text-align:right }
#nav_oben { position:absolute; left:269px; top:59px; font-weight:bold}
#nav_oben a { text-decoration:none }
#grafik_oben { position:absolute; left:0px; top:80px; }
#volltextsuche { position:absolute; left:66px; top:188px; }
#grafik_oben_r { position:absolute; left:255px; top:80px; }
#text_oben1 { position:absolute; left:268px; top:153px; color:white;font-size:26px;font-weight:bold }
#text_oben2 { position:absolute; left:268px; top:102px; color:white;font-size:14px;font-weight:bold;width:468px }
#frame_links { position:absolute; left:0px; top:250px; width:249px; }
#content { padding-left:267px; padding-top:209px; width:697px; min-height:560px; background-color:white;}

.kasten_grau { border:1px solid #EDEDEC; background-color:#f7f7f7; margin:4px;padding:4px }

table.obj_liste { margin-bottom:10px }
.obj_liste td {    }
.obj_liste h2 { font-size:100%; margin:0}
.obj_liste p { margin:0; }

.grau { color:#999999 }

.kalender .grau {color:#cccccc}
.kalender .fb {background-color:#00FF00;cursor:pointer;background-image:url(img/gn-rot.gif);background-repeat:no-repeat}
.kalender .bf {background-color:#00ff00;cursor:pointer;background-image:url(img/rot-gn.gif);background-repeat:no-repeat}
.kalender .f {background-color:#00FF00;cursor:pointer}
.kalender .b {background-color:#ff3300}
.kalender .a {background-color:#dddddd;cursor:pointer}

h2 { font-size:130% }

textarea { font-family:arial; font-size:12px }

#tooltip {position: absolute; display: none; font-size: 0.8em; background-color: #ffffff; border: 1px solid #000000; padding: 2px 5px 2px 5px;
 	-moz-opacity: 0.9;
	filter:alpha(Opacity=90);
}

a.link1:link, a.link1:visited { text-decoration:none; color:white; cursor:pointer }

@media print {
    body { background-image:none; background-color:transparent  }
    
    #seite { width:auto;margin:0;background-color:transparent}
    #seite2 { position:static;width:auto;background-color:transparent }
    
    #logo,#hotline,#nav_oben,#grafik_oben,#volltextsuche,#grafik_oben_r,#frame_links,#unten,#text_oben1,#text_oben2,#sprache { display:none }
    #content { left:0;top:0;margin:0px;padding:0px;width:96%;background-color:transparent }
}

.box700_m1 { background-image:url(/site/img/box700_m1.gif); }
.box700_m2 { background-image:url(/site/img/box700_m2.gif); }
.box700_o { background-image:url(/site/img/box700_o.gif); width:700px; height:6px;}
.box700_u { background-image:url(/site/img/box700_u.gif); width:700px; height:7px;}
